Job Summary

  • This role supports the planning, coordination, and delivery of initiatives that modernize credit processes and strengthen portfolio performance across the customer credit lifecycle.
  • The Senior Manager partners closely with Lending, Risk, Product, Fraud, Collections, Operations, Finance, Technology, and Compliance to ensure initiatives are well-designed and delivered with discipline.
  • BMO offers a comprehensive total compensation package including health insurance, tuition reimbursement, accident and life insurance, and retirement savings plans.
